Zeteo Biomedical, a pioneering force in biopharmaceutical drug delivery solutions, has officially announced its relocation to Cedar Park, Texas. This move marks a significant boost for Cedar Park’s reputation as a burgeoning business hub and showcases the city’s dedication to supporting innovative advancements in healthcare technology.
Renowned for its cutting-edge research and development in drug and biologic delivery devices, Zeteo Biomedical collaborates with global pharmaceutical and biotech firms to develop treatments for various infectious diseases, neurodegenerative conditions, autoimmune disorders, and ocular diseases. Zeteo Biomedical’s relocation aligns with Cedar Park’s strategic initiative to establish a thriving life sciences cluster in the Austin, Texas region. This move aims to foster investment and growth for companies in the sector, solidifying Cedar Park as a key destination for life sciences innovation.
